Re: Difference between a 674 and 574 IHC

Hi, the 574 and 674 Diesel both had the D239 German Diesel but the 674 had larger rear tires 18.4-30 vs 16.9-28 for 574. The 674 could also have a different speed transmission than the 574. We had a 674 without T/A for a short period of time but it had a slow speed transmission and 2nd gear was to slow and 3rd was to fast for our JD corn harvester. Traded it for 684 with T/A. Neighbor had 574 and turned up injection pump so it was putting out 66 HP on dyno same as our 684. Therefore 674 maybe a little heavier than 574 due to larger tire size. My 2 cents JB2
